The actual natural/ACT base in the all-order local axis recursion #

The finite base functions below are the constructed holomorphic natural/ACT functions. Every regularity field required by SlowRecursion is derived from those functions. In particular the angular slow coefficient is C*f.

Holomorphic parameter extension of the evaluated axis space #

The extension is the convergent vertical Taylor series of the genuine compatible parameter jets. Its Cauchy--Riemann identity follows by termwise differentiation.

Joint smoothness of the actual holomorphic axis profile #

The uniform bounds for the next radial derivative imply continuity in the supremum norm on every closed parameter disk. A uniform mean-value remainder then identifies the actual derivative of the disk-valued curve. Iterating this argument and using the fixed-contour holomorphic-family theorem proves joint real smoothness of the constructed extension.

A common holomorphic parameter neighborhood through initial activation #

All continuations below are explicit integrals of the actual natural slopes. The complex neighborhood is obtained from compactness and real positivity.
